Output 64ffafe4e565112966dcc4583fe38dfbb7514892e672095a8ff758d0a2ec5645:1

value
102353588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e802fd74e871f22f7ba2d8091007b9f62ef119e9 OP_EQUALVERIFY OP_CHECKSIG
address
DSHrtWudx16pJEvLg9DWXYFVHhG8cKLhcr
transaction
64ffafe4e565112966dcc4583fe38dfbb7514892e672095a8ff758d0a2ec5645